The size of Farrar is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. There are 4 parks, covering nearly 7.2% of the total area. The population of Farrar in 2016 was 1518 people. By 2021 the population was 1650 showing a population growth of 8.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Farrar is 30-39 years. Households in Farrar are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Farrar work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 55.80% of the homes in Farrar were owner-occupied compared with 52.00% in 2016.
